Immigration Closes Services Until 24 March, International Crossings Remain Monitored 24 Hours
The Directorate General of Immigration of the Ministry of Immigration and Corrections (Ditjenim Kemenimipas) is temporarily closing immigration services during the holidays and collective leave for Nyepi Day and Eid al-Fitr. Services will be closed from today until 24 March 2026. Quoted from the official Ditjenim Kemenimipas website, Wednesday (18/3/2026), immigration office services will resume operations on 25 March 2026. Although administrative services at immigration offices are on holiday, monitoring and checks at international crossings will continue normally. “Arrival and departure areas at international airports and seaports will remain operational 24 hours. Visa on Arrival services will also remain open to serve foreign tourists,” explained the Acting Director General of Immigration, Yuldi Yusman. Yuldi also stated that in cases of emergency passport issuance, such as for unavoidable medical purposes, applicants can contact the hotline of the nearest immigration office. Based on the Joint Ministerial Decree of 3 Ministers on National Holidays and Collective Leave 2026, long holidays for Eid al-Fitr with Nyepi Day have been set. The details are as follows: Wednesday, 18 March 2026: Collective leave for the Holy Day of Nyepi, New Year Saka 1948 Thursday, 19 March 2026: Holy Day of Nyepi, New Year Saka 1948 Friday, 20 March 2026: Collective leave for Eid al-Fitr 1447 Hijriah Saturday, 21 March 2026: Eid al-Fitr 1447 Hijriah Sunday, 22 March 2026: Eid al-Fitr 1447 Hijriah Monday, 23 March 2026: Collective leave for Eid al-Fitr 1447 Hijriah Tuesday, 24 March 2026: Collective leave for Eid al-Fitr 1447 Hijriah
